Brief summary
The primary objective of the study is to evaluate safety and efficacy of ELAD with respect to overall survival of subjects with a clinical diagnosis of alcohol-induced liver decompensation (AILD) through at least Study Day 91. The secondary objective is to evaluate the proportion of survivors at Study Day 91 using a chi-squared test.
Detailed description
The ITT population includes all randomized subjects assigned to the group to which they were randomized, irrespective of actual treatment administered. Participant, Baseline Characteristics, and Outcome Measures used the ITT population. The safety population is defined as all subjects who are randomized based on actual treatment received. All serious adverse events and all non-serious adverse events analyses used the safety population.

Eligibility
Inclusion criteria
Subjects must meet ALL inclusion criteria to be eligible for the study: 1. Age ≥18; 2. Total bilirubin ≥16 mg/dL (≥273.6 µmol/L); 3. A clinical diagnosis of alcohol-induced liver decompensation (AILD), based upon lab test or medical history or family interview with a causal relationship and temporal association (6 weeks or less) of alcohol use and hospital admission for this episode of AILD; 4. Maddrey score ≥32; 5. Subjects must have AILD that is severe acute alcoholic hepatitis (sAAH) diagnosed with either: a. A confirmatory liver biopsy, OR b. Two or more of the following: i. Hepatomegaly, ii. AST \> ALT, iii. Ascites, iv. Leukocytosis (WBC count above lab normal at site); Note: Subjects will be classified as either: 1. AILD that is sAAH with no underlying liver disease other than alcoholic liver disease, OR 2. AILD that is sAAH with evidence of underlying liver disease other than alcoholic liver disease which must be documented by: i. Liver biopsy, AND/OR ii. Laboratory findings, AND/OR iii. Medical history; 6. Not eligible for liver transplant during this hospitalization; 7. Subject or legally-authorized representative must provide Informed Consent; 8. Subject must be eligible for Standard of Care treatment as defined in the protocol.

Participant flow
Participants by arm
| Arm | Count |
|---|---|
| ELAD System This group will receive treatment with ELAD plus standard of care therapy.
ELAD System: An extracorporeal human hepatic cell-based liver treatment | 78 |
| Standard of Care (Control) This group will receive standard of care therapy as defined in the protocol.
Standard of Care (Control): Standard medical treatment as defined by the protocol | 73 |
| Total | 151 |

Outcome results
Overall Survival
The primary endpoint of the study was a comparison of overall survival (OS) between the ELAD-treated and Control groups, with protocol VTL-308E providing additional survival data up to a maximum of 5 years, that was included as available at the time of database lock (28 Aug 2018).
Time frame: Up to at least Study Day 91, with protocol VTL-308E providing additional survival data (at 6, 9, 12, 24 months) at the time of database lock (28 August 2018).
| Arm | Measure | Value (COUNT_OF_PARTICIPANTS) |
|---|---|---|
| ELAD System | Overall Survival | 55 Participants |
| Standard of Care (Control) | Overall Survival | 51 Participants |
Number of Subjects With Early Change in Bilirubin Levels at Study Day 7
To estimate the effect of ELAD on the number of subjects achieving a 20% reduction in total bilirubin by Day 7 (ECBL20 Yes)
Time frame: Up to Study Day 7
| Arm | Measure | Value (COUNT_OF_PARTICIPANTS) |
|---|---|---|
| ELAD System | Number of Subjects With Early Change in Bilirubin Levels at Study Day 7 | 38 Participants |
| Standard of Care (Control) | Number of Subjects With Early Change in Bilirubin Levels at Study Day 7 | 24 Participants |
Number of Survivors at Study Day 91
Assess the proportion of survivors at Study Day 91
Time frame: Up to Study Day 91
| Arm | Measure | Value (COUNT_OF_PARTICIPANTS) |
|---|---|---|
| ELAD System | Number of Survivors at Study Day 91 | 63 Participants |
| Standard of Care (Control) | Number of Survivors at Study Day 91 | 57 Participants |
